How Success Happens tells the inspiring, entertaining, and unexpected journeys that influential leaders in business, the arts and sports traveled on their way to becoming household names. Hosted by Entrepreneur Media’s VP of Special Projects Dan Bova, these conversations are a must-listen for anyone looking to pave their own path to success.

Jeanie Buss, Owner and President of the Los Angeles Lakers, on Women Leading in Sports and Content

Jeanie Buss is the owner and president of the Los Angeles Lakers, a 17-time championship-winning basketball team in the National Basketball Association. In 2020, Jeanie became the first female controlling owner to lead an NBA team to a championship title. Jeanie is also the co-owner of Women Of Wrestling (WOW), the only all-female wrestling organization. Chris Rondeau, CEO of Planet Fitness, on Building a Fitness Franchise

Chris Rondeau is the CEO of Planet Fitness, one of the largest fitness franchises in the world built on instilling a judgment-free zone environment. Chris started at the company in 1992, working the front desk at the first location. He eventually became Chief Operating Officer in 2003 and Chief Executive Officer in 2013. Marc Gorlin, Founder of Roadie, On New Type of Delivery Platform

Marc Gorlin is the founder and CEO of crowdsourced delivery platform Roadie, which he launched in 2014. Roadie puts unused capacity in passenger vehicles to work by connecting people with items to send with drivers heading in the right direction. The company works with consumers and businesses across almost every industry to enable a faster, cheaper and more scalable solution for same-day and urgent delivery.
